
ZK rollups são uma solução inovadora de escalabilidade de camada 2 que aprimora o desempenho das blockchains, mantendo segurança e descentralização. Conforme Ethereum e outras redes blockchain enfrentam aumento de demanda, os ZK rollups se destacam como uma tecnologia promissora para superar os desafios de escalabilidade, sem comprometer os princípios essenciais dos sistemas de registros distribuídos.
Crypto rollup é uma tecnologia fundamental de escalabilidade que agrupa diversas transações de criptomoedas para processamento conjunto. Essa abordagem transfere a execução das transações para fora da blockchain principal, mantendo os dados armazenados on-chain, e reduz consideravelmente a carga computacional sobre a rede principal.
Os rollups funcionam via softwares especializados fora da cadeia, responsáveis por verificar e organizar os dados das transações antes de enviar lotes à blockchain de camada 1 em intervalos regulares. Smart contracts conectam os sistemas rollup de camada 2 às blockchains principais, garantindo descentralização e ausência de necessidade de confiança.
As vantagens dos rollups são expressivas. Ao processar transações fora da cadeia, eles aliviam a congestão na blockchain principal e melhoram o desempenho da rede. Protocolos de rollup comprimem grandes volumes de dados em formatos compactos, otimizando o espaço dos blocos nas redes de camada 1. Isso resulta em confirmações mais rápidas, maior capacidade de processamento e taxas menores para os usuários. Além disso, ao distribuir atividades por várias camadas, os rollups ajudam a evitar gargalos graves nas redes principais.
ZK rollups utilizam provas de conhecimento zero como método exclusivo de verificação. Neste modelo, computadores da rede zkrollup realizam cálculos complexos fora da cadeia antes de enviar lotes de transações à blockchain principal. Cada envio inclui uma prova de validade—um certificado criptográfico que comprova a organização e verificação correta do histórico das transações.
O termo "conhecimento zero" indica que os validadores da blockchain de camada 1 recebem pouquíssima informação sobre transações individuais. As provas de validade, entretanto, oferecem certeza matemática de que processadores fora da cadeia dedicaram recursos computacionais substanciais para validar as transações. Isso cria um modelo de confiança em que a cadeia principal verifica a integridade das transações sem processar cada uma separadamente.
ZK rollups usam um mecanismo de verificação similar ao consenso proof-of-work. Os processadores da rede zkrollup solucionam algoritmos complexos para gerar provas de validade para seus lotes de transações. Esse requisito computacional estabelece uma barreira de segurança robusta contra agentes maliciosos que tentem submeter transações fraudulentas.
A grande diferença entre zkrollup e blockchains tradicionais proof-of-work está no local de operação. ZK rollups realizam toda a verificação fora da rede principal, comprimindo os dados das transações antes de transferi-los à cadeia via smart contracts. Essa arquitetura une a segurança da verificação computacional intensiva à eficiência do processamento off-chain.
Optimistic rollups oferecem uma abordagem alternativa de escalabilidade de camada 2, com métodos de verificação distintos. Diferentemente dos zkrollups, optimistic rollups não produzem provas de validade para cada lote de transações. Esses sistemas funcionam sob a suposição de que todas as transações enviadas são válidas—daí o nome "optimistic".
Optimistic rollups dependem de provas de fraude em vez de provas de validade. Participantes da rede podem contestar transações suspeitas durante um período de disputa. Se algum nó identificar irregularidades, sinaliza a transação para revisão. Transações permanecem retidas até o fim do período de verificação, a menos que haja reclamações de fraude comprovadas.
Para garantir a integridade da rede, protocolos optimistic rollup exigem que nós depositem criptomoedas como garantia. Transações inválidas levam à perda do depósito, e as recompensas vão para quem identificar atividades fraudulentas com sucesso.
A escolha entre esses métodos envolve velocidade e flexibilidade. ZK rollups oferecem finalização muito mais rápida, já que as transações vêm pré-verificadas por provas de validade. Já os optimistic rollups podem exigir espera de vários dias—até mais de uma semana—para finalização das transações. Em contrapartida, optimistic rollups demandam menos poder computacional e dão maior flexibilidade a desenvolvedores, facilitando integração com aplicações descentralizadas já existentes.
ZK rollups trazem múltiplas vantagens para a escalabilidade de blockchains. Segurança máxima é o principal destaque—provas de validade rigorosas garantem que somente dados verificados cheguem à blockchain de camada 1, eliminando dependência de modelos de segurança baseados em teoria dos jogos. Taxas reduzidas vêm da compressão eficiente dos dados, permitindo milhares de transações em pouco espaço de bloco. O maior processamento resulta da validação computacional fora da cadeia principal, o que diminui riscos de congestionamento e aprimora o desempenho da rede.
Por outro lado, zkrollups também apresentam limitações. Apesar de mais econômicos que transações de camada 1, exigem mais recursos computacionais que alternativas como optimistic rollups, o que pode resultar em taxas ligeiramente superiores em relação a outras soluções. O alto grau técnico dos ZK rollups reduz sua flexibilidade para desenvolvedores, que muitas vezes precisam reestruturar aplicações ao migrar para sistemas zkrollup. Além disso, requisitos intensivos de hardware podem limitar a participação na rede, elevando riscos de centralização devido ao número reduzido de validadores.
Vários projetos de destaque impulsionam a tecnologia zkrollup no universo blockchain. Polygon, anteriormente Matic Network, oferece soluções completas de escalabilidade de camada 2 para Ethereum, incluindo zkEVM, que leva a segurança e velocidade dos zkrollups ao ecossistema expandido do Ethereum.
StarkWare Industries desenvolveu duas soluções relevantes: StarkEx, uma plataforma SaaS permissionada que auxilia criadores de aplicações descentralizadas a implementar tecnologia ZK, e StarkNet, sistema permissionless aberto a qualquer desenvolvedor para integrar ZK rollups em seus projetos.
Immutable X é voltada para jogos blockchain e negociação de tokens não fungíveis, usando zkrollup para oferecer mais segurança, maior velocidade e taxas menores. Jogos populares utilizam a infraestrutura Immutable X para melhorar a experiência dos usuários, mantendo a segurança do Ethereum. Esses projetos seguem mostrando aplicações práticas e benefícios dos zkrollups em diferentes contextos.
ZK rollups significam um avanço importante na escalabilidade de blockchains, oferecendo uma solução eficiente para desafios de desempenho e custos de rede. Ao combinar provas criptográficas de validade com processamento de transações fora da cadeia, as soluções zkrollup aumentam a capacidade de processamento e reduzem taxas, sem abrir mão de segurança. Apesar de apresentarem limitações quanto a requisitos computacionais e flexibilidade para desenvolvimento, em comparação a alternativas como optimistic rollups, seu modelo de segurança superior e finalização mais ágil fazem deles uma opção cada vez mais relevante para desenvolvedores e usuários. Conforme a tecnologia amadurece e mais projetos adotam zkrollups, esses sistemas se consolidam como parte fundamental da infraestrutura blockchain escalável e segura. O desenvolvimento contínuo e a implementação dos zkrollups seguem impulsionando a adoção de aplicações blockchain em diversos setores, estabelecendo esse conceito como pilar da arquitetura moderna de blockchains.
Zkrollup é uma solução de escalabilidade Layer 2 que agrupa transações fora da cadeia e utiliza provas de conhecimento zero para validá-las na cadeia principal, permitindo finalização mais rápida e custos menores.
StarkNet é um exemplo de ZK rollup, solução de camada 2 que processa computação fora da cadeia e agrupa dados de transações na blockchain.
ZK significa Zero-Knowledge, método criptográfico usado para provar afirmações sem revelar informações adicionais. É empregado em ZK Rollups para escalar blockchains como Ethereum, com zk-SNARKs e zk-STARKs como principais tipos de prova.
ZK rollups garantem taxas de gás menores, transações mais rápidas e maior escalabilidade, mantendo a segurança do Ethereum. Processam várias transações fora da cadeia, otimizando a eficiência.





